Gazprom Armenia Denies Sabotage: Clarifies Payments for Gas Consumption in January

Complaints from a number of subscribers regarding the amounts paid for consumed natural gas during the heating season are recurring. This has been an issue in previous heating periods as well, and it's not the first time,” said Mikhail Harutyunyan, an employee of Gazprom Armenia’s public relations and media department, in an interview with the newspaper ‘Haykakan Zhamanak’.

In recent days, social media users have been actively discussing that during January, compared to December, they paid significantly more for the gas consumed. Citizens also claim that there have been no changes to the heating systems in their apartments. Some people even link this to the increase in gas prices at the Armenian border, suggesting that it is sabotage.

“The increase in certain consumption volumes among subscribers is mainly attributed to the external air temperature. This results in greater thermal losses from the exterior walls of apartments and houses. These thermal losses must be compensated with a larger volume of gas consumption,” Harutyunyan stated, adding that Gazprom Armenia is prepared to address each complaint individually, providing a history of consumption to allow comparisons with previous years.

“In other words, we are ready to respond to each complaint from every subscriber. In any issue, subscribers not only can but should contact Gazprom Armenia to receive answers to their raised questions or to resolve their problems,” Harutyunyan noted. When the media pointed out that the public is discussing whether this is sabotage related to the increase in gas prices at the border, Harutyunyan responded: “We categorically disagree with such claims and do not intend to comment on that.”
